Transaction 259545d34d13769201edad3b98a54bbfcafeb18f7127deacf36c66b2736b3156
2 Input
2 Outputs
- 259545d34d13769201edad3b98a54bbfcafeb18f7127deacf36c66b2736b3156:0
- 259545d34d13769201edad3b98a54bbfcafeb18f7127deacf36c66b2736b3156:1
value 138194
address 1GskLk4qfwy1wkvSkXNj3egUvXPuMrY6rM
value 26590
address 1PxXFwByzdLoe2d4UKYAN4ExTEbM1G97By